How to open a gif file with non-default application

by newbie_coder (Initiate)
Greeting monks

In my perl script, few graphs are plotted using GDGraph module. As soon as the plotting is done, I want to open these graphs with a specific application(not the default one).I have tried using

system(qq(start "$full_filename"));

But it returns the following error

start: Unknown job: Line_uptime_1.gif

Please suggest me the right way

Re: How to open a gif file with non-default application
by ikegami (Pope) on Nov 17, 2010 at 07:27 UTC

    start will use the default application, so I don't see why you're still using start.

    system("c:\specific\application.exe image.gif");

    Actual usage may vary by application.

Re: How to open a gif file with non-default application
by kcott (Chancellor) on Nov 17, 2010 at 07:19 UTC

    Determine what works from the commandline and use that.

    You probably want something like: start application_name filename

    Perhaps you need quoting, switches or similar.

    As you haven't told us what this non-default application is, it's rather difficult to advise what syntax you should be using.

    -- Ken

